About this role
A Postdoctoral Fellow position in the Yang Lab, Department of Surgery at St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ital focused on translational research targeting splicing factors to enhance immunotherapy efficacy for high-risk neuroblastoma. The role centers on mechanistic and translational studies using genetic, epigenomic, and pharmacologic approaches in patient-derived xenografts and genetically engineered mouse models to inform improved immunotherapies.
